影響因子Modern microelectronic design is characterized by theintegration of full systems on a single die. These systems ofteninclude large highperformance digital circuitry, high resolutionanalog parts, high driving I/O, and maybe RF sections. Designers ofsuch systems are constantly faced with the challenge to achievecompatibility in electrical characteristics of every section: somecircuitry presents fast transients and large consumption spikes,whereas others require quiet environments to achieve resolutions wellbeyond millivolts. Coupling between those sections is usuallyunavoidable, since the entire system shares the same silicon substratebulk and the same package. Understanding the way coupling is produced,and knowing methods to isolate coupled circuitry, and how to applyevery method, is then mandatory knowledge for every IC designer. ..Analysis and Solutions for Switching Noise Coupling inMixed-Signal. .ICs. is an in-depth look at coupling through thecommon silicon substrate, and noise at the power supply lines. Alternative proposals for reducing substrate noise, few localized elements. Lastly, we study the viability of using active guards. The technique is similar to the canceling method, but in this case noisy elements are not duplicated, adding instead a circuit which senses noise and creates compensating noise, thus annulling the first one, for instance through negative feedback.
